필라델피아 정보
Philadelphia, located in the state of Pennsylvania, is known for its rich history and iconic landmarks such as the Liberty Bell and Independence Hall. The currency used in Philadelphia is the US Dollar. The city offers a diverse culinary scene, vibrant arts and culture, and a mix of modern and historic architecture. Visitors can explore museums, enjoy street art, and indulge in delicious Philly cheesesteaks. The city is also home to beautiful parks and gardens, perfect for outdoor activities.
When to visit
The best time to visit Philadelphia is during the spring (March to May) and fall (September to November) when the weather is mild and pleasant. Summer (June to August) can be hot and humid, while winter (December to February) can be cold with occasional snowfall. The city hosts various events and festivals throughout the year, so check the calendar for specific attractions.
Getting around
Philadelphia has an extensive public transportation system including buses, trolleys, and subway lines, making it easy to navigate the city. Visitors can also use rideshare services, taxis, or rent bicycles to explore the city. Walking is a popular option in the compact downtown area, while driving is convenient for those looking to venture outside the city.
Traveller tips
When visiting Philadelphia, be sure to explore the historic district and visit iconic sites like the Liberty Bell and Independence Hall. Try a Philly cheesesteak from one of the city's famous eateries and sample local craft beers. Take a stroll along the Schuylkill River Trail or visit the Philadelphia Museum of Art. Be prepared for varying weather conditions and wear comfortable shoes for walking.
